    • In May of 2026, it looks like a challenging schedule...and it probably is.  I rarely listen to the "strength of schedule" conversations that light up social media this time of year. Each year teams improve and decline. I think there's chunks of the year we need to take care of business and the week 5 bye is not desired.  I do think if we don't hit the bye week at 3-1, it's going to be a major uphill battle given the schedule in front of us. This season falls on three people, regardless of schedule strength: Canales, Bryce, Evero.  Canales: Finally can truly coach all aspects of the team and not focus with gameday prep for OC duties anymore. He drives the bus and needs to get these guys in position to win each week. There's no way vets come in and put it on the line every week to watch our QB sh!t the bed (See: SF game last year). Bryce: Despite everyone's obsession with thinking Bryce is a guaranteed extension, I think this year will truly be his "prove it" year. If he comes out the way he has the past three years, I really don't see how vets and coaches can continue to put him under center long-term. He might play out that fifth year as the starter, but I think next offseason his long-term replacement is found. I also think there's no excuses with the weapons and commitment we've made on offense to insulate him with every possible weapon.  Evero: Best personnel he's had since he's been here...no excuses. Figure out how to blitz effectively. Figure out how to use CBs whose strengths are press/man. Figure out how to utilize a talented front-7 to get the hell of the field. Outside of FS and maybe....maybe ILB, there are few weaknesses on this unit.
